192 S Single Setpoint
Pneumatic Room Thermostats
Features
• Single setpoint dial available in Fa.hrenheit or Celsius scales.
• Direct or reverse acting models
• Sensitive bimetallic element
responds to temperature
changes .
• Integral, adjustable limit stops.
• Wall mounting plate included for
easy connection to rough-in
boxes.
Applications
Designed for heating and cooling
applications for control of pneumatic valves and damper actuators, the
192 S Single Setpoint Pneumatic Room Thermostat is excellent for
commercial and institutional facilities.
These are available with both 1-pipe and 2-pipe configurations.
1-pipe: Use when limited output air capacity is required to operate a
single valve and/or actuator; requires external restrictor, 20 scim (5.4
ml/s) air supply.
2-pipe: Use for high output capacity for control of multiple valves and
actuators, used with or without high/low limiting controls.

192 HC Heating/Cooling
Pneumatic Room Thermostat
Features
• Dual setpoint dials available in Fahrenheit or Celsius scales.
• Direct or reverse acting models.
• Sensitive bimetallic element
responds to temperature
changes .
• Integral, adjustable limit stops.
• Adjustable changeover pressure.
• Large volume air capacity rela.y
Applications
Designed for temperature control of
heating and cooling applications, the
192 HC Heating/Cooling Pneumatic Room Thermostat controls valves
and damper actuators in cooling equipment. Providing energy
management and occupant comfort, the thermostat automatically
adjusts to seasonal changes from heating setpoint to cooling setpoint in
commercial and institutional facilities. It is available in a 2-pipe
configuration.

192 DN/DNV Day/Night/Vent
Pneumatic Room Thermostats
Features
• Dual setpoint dials available in Fahrenheit or Celsius scales.
• Direct or reverse acting models.
• Sensitive bimetallic element
responds to temperature
changes .
• Manual override selector for off-
hour occupant comfort.
• Adjustable changeover pressure.
Applications
The 192 DN/DNV Pneumatic Room
Thermostat controls valves and
damper actuators in cooling equipment, automatically performing
setback changes from day to night. The 192 DNV also performs a purge
sequence at night to bring in “vent” outside air to cool the building. A
manual override selector switch allows individual room or zone “day”
control locally during the night cycle. During the night control cycle, the
192 DNV models provide a separate output signal (full air supply)
allowing ventilation control. Periodic resetting to the “night” control
mode during evening or weekend periods using time clocks ensures
optimal energy management.

193 HC Free Energy Band Heating/Cooling
Pneumatic Room Thermostats
Features
• Dual setpoint dials available in Fahrenheit or Celsius scales.
• Integral, adjustable limit stops.
• Sensitive bimetallic element
responds to temperature
changes .
• Adjustable Free Energy Band.
• Wall mounting plate included for
easy connection to rough-in
boxes.
Applications
Designed for buildings with early morning heat requirements and mid-
morning to afternoon cooling requirements, the 193 HC Free Energy
Band Pneumatic Room Thermostat two temperature thermostat
controls valves, damper actuators and mechanical heating and cooling
equipment. Providing energy management and occupant comfort, the
thermostat automatically reduces heating load and increases cooling
load.
2-pipe (dual 1-pipe): Use when a limited air capacity is required to
operate a single valve and/or actuator.
3-pipe (dual 2-pipe): Use for multiple valves and actuators with or
without high/low limiting controls which require higher air capacities.
